WebMalic was a word that just simply, for Duchamp, meant male. A word that he made up. He often created linguistic forms. In the center at the bottom, we can see what he referred to as a chocolate grinder. Above that a series of sieves and giant scissors. And to the right, a little bit difficult to see, and seen obliquely, are optical devices. Includes animation of The Large Glass See more The Large Glass consists of two glass panels, suspended vertically and measuring 109.25 in × 69.25 in (277.5 cm × 175.9 cm).
